Risk Assessment 101 (June)

Date: 25th June 2024 Between: 7:30 pm - 9:00 pm Location: Perdiswell Young Peoples' Leisure Centre, Droitwich Road, Worcester, WR3 7SN

Suitable for volunteers of all sections, Squirrels to Explorers. No pre-learning needed.

If you’ve never written a risk assessment before, or find them challenging, then this is for you!

This is a development session designed to build confidence in creating risk assessments, making them simple and effective and thus reducing the paperwork.  Areas covered will be:-

  • What purpose do they serve?
  • What do they look like?
  • Demystifying terms, untangling hazards and risks
  • How do we minimise our chance of missing something?
  • What can be done to reduce the risk?
  • What else do we need to do?
  • How and what to communicate and to who

Participants are asked to bring along examples of programmes that they would like to create a risk assessment for to enable real life scenarios to be practiced.
